1.servicenow CRM中提供的电话字段类型有哪些
我注意到以下两种类型
1) Phone Number(Only with standard fields like Business phone,mobile phone,home phone in customer contact)
2) Phone Number(E164)(while creating/editing a custom field).
2.以及这两种类型有什么区别以及为什么在创建新字段时电话号码类型不可用。
以下是我的发现
电话字段类型:
对于标准电话字段,如商务电话和移动电话,显示为电话号码的类型和行为是,当我尝试时,它会将格式更改为 (314) 567-8912(在 UI 中并以这种格式存储在 CRM 中)保存号码,如 3145678912。
使用电话号码(E164)类型 - 它列出国家(地区)并在 CRM UI 中应用验证规则并存储带有国家代码和电话号码的号码,例如 +918012345678。
搜索电话号码:
在 CRM UI 或仅使用 REST API 搜索电话号码时,仅使用精确格式,它正在获取记录。例如:如果数字以这种格式存储(314)567-8912,只有用(314)567-8912搜索才能得到记录,有没有办法以替代方式获取这种格式记录
https://myinstance.service-now.com/api/now/contact?sysparm_query=phoneSTARTSWITH(314) 567-8912 - >正在工作
https://myinstance.service-now.com/api/now/contact?sysparm_query=phoneSTARTSWITH3145678912 -> 它没有获取记录
https://myinstance.service-now.com/api/now/contact?sysparm_query=phoneLIKE3145678912- >它也没有获取
似乎只能使用确切的格式进行搜索-> 我是对的吗?如果有任何问题请纠正我